Beyoncé, also known as "Queen Bey" or "Queen B," is an American singer, songwriter, dancer, actress, business executive, philanthropist, and cultural icon. She began her career as a member of Girl's Tyme, an R&B group she helped form in 1990. In 1997, the band changed its name to Destiny's Child. In 2002, Beyoncé launched her solo career with a feature on Jay-Z's "03 Bonnie and Clyde." That year, they formed the duo "The Carters," and in 2003, Beyoncé's "Crazy in Love", which featured a verse from Jay-Z, became her number-one hit single in the US. That year she also dropped her debut album "Dangerously in Love," the first of seven to consecutively peak at number one on the Billboard 200 chart. Her latest album "Renaissance" dropped in 2022. In 2008, Beyoncé and Jay-Z wed. Their first daughter Blue Ivy was born in 2012 with twins following in 2017.
